KVM: x86/pmu: Ignore pmu->global_ctrl check if vPMU doesn't support global_ctrl
[ Upstream commit 98defd2e17803263f49548fea930cfc974d505aa ] MSR_CORE_PERF_GLOBAL_CTRL is introduced as part of Architecture PMU V2, as indicated by Intel SDM 19.2.2 and the intel_is_valid_msr() function. So in the absence of global_ctrl support, all PMCs are enabled as AMD does.
